SOAR - March 1
But those who hope in the Lord will renew their strength. They will soar on wings like eagles; they will run and not grow weary; they will walk and not be faint. Isaiah 40:31 (NIV)
Success is not final, failure is not fatal: It is the courage to continue that counts."
- Winston S. Churchill
The scripture from Isaiah 40:31 beautifully portrays the promise of renewed strength for those who place their hope in the Lord. The imagery of soaring on wings like eagles suggests a level of freedom and elevation beyond our own capabilities. This verse teaches us that our strength, when rooted in God, transcends mere endurance; it propels us to heights we could not reach on our own.
Consider the eagle, a bird known for its ability to soar at great altitudes. Similarly, when we anchor our hope in God, our spirits are lifted, and we are empowered to face life's challenges with resilience. The promise of running without growing weary and walking without fainting encompasses the various aspects of our journey, reminding us that God's renewal is comprehensive and enduring.
Cultivate the courage it takes to continue, regardless of success or failure. Just as momentum builds with each step forward, our faith deepens as we courageously press on, trusting in God's promises.
